What Is a PET/CT Scan—and How Can It Help?

A PET/CT scan is a powerful tool that combines two advanced imaging technologies—positron emission tomography (PET) and computed tomography (CT)—to give a detailed view of how your body is functioning. It can detect abnormal activity at a cellular level, even before physical symptoms become obvious.

It’s commonly used in cancer diagnosis and management, but more and more people are using it as a proactive step for early cancer screening.
